Ether Plunges 8% Amid $1.4B ETF Outflow and Long-Term Investor Sell-Off

Ethereum’s Sharp Decline Amidst Broader Crypto Market Turbulence

On a tumultuous Friday, Ethereum (ETH) experienced a‌ critically important drop, falling below ‌the $3,100 mark⁢ as part of a wider crypto market downturn that⁢ also saw Bitcoin dip below‌ the‌ once-unthinkable $100,000 threshold.

A Steep Descent for Ethereum

From Thursday to early⁤ friday, Ethereum saw its value decrease dramatically from $3,565 to just above $3,060-wiping out gains from ⁣the previous week’s recovery. The cryptocurrency⁣ later found some footing around $3,198.96 but still recorded an approximate 8% decline within 24 hours.

Market Influences and Economic Factors

This downturn coincided ‌with a broader market selloff affecting U.S. stocks and bonds ⁣alike. Contributing factors included the⁤ recent⁢ conclusion of‍ a U.S. government shutdown which had put additional strain on⁢ liquidity conditions. Moreover,expectations‍ have ⁣shifted regarding the ⁣Federal Reserve’s interest rate decisions for December; predictions now lean ⁢towards maintaining current rates⁢ rather ​than decreasing them.

As late October when Fed Chair Jerome Powell dampened ‌hopes for ‌expected rate cuts in December‍ at their⁤ meeting, there has been notable financial movement: U.S.-listed spot Ether ​ETFs have seen substantial net outflows totaling approximately $1.4 billion according ​to⁤ farside Investors ​data-with Thursday marking one of ⁢the largest ‍single-day withdrawals in recent⁢ times at nearly $260 million.

Investor Behavior ⁤and Blockchain Data Insights

Data from Glassnode reveals that long-term holders (those holding for between three to ten​ years) are increasingly moving‍ away from their ⁢positions in ETH-selling ⁣around 45,000 ETH daily based on a 90-day ⁤moving average ⁢as of late-a pace not seen ⁣since February 2021.

Blockchain analytics further highlight ‌weakening fundamentals within the network: active monthly addresses have ⁣decreased to about 8.2⁢ million from over‌ 9 million in September; simultaneously occurring ​transaction⁤ fees collected over the last month plummeted by 42%, totaling just⁤ $27 million according to Token Terminal figures.
